Isaiah 54:12
And I will make thy windows of agates, and thy gates of carbuncles, and all thy borders of pleasant stones.
Cross-reference
Isaiah 44:26 promises God will rebuild Jerusalem, the same restoration context as the precious stones imagery.
Isaiah 49:16 says 'your walls are continually before me,' emphasizing God's focus on Jerusalem's walls as here.
1 Chronicles 29:2 lists David's provision of precious stones for the temple, directly echoing the building with gemstones.
2 Chronicles 3:6 records Solomon adorning the temple with precious stones, a clear parallel to the walls of precious stones.
Revelation 21:19 lists foundations adorned with precious stones, directly echoing Isaiah's wall of rubies and precious stones.
Revelation 21:12 describes the New Jerusalem's gates and wall, echoing Isaiah's vision of a restored city with precious gates.
Exodus 28:17 lists precious stones on the high priest's breastpiece, paralleling the use of gemstones to adorn sacred structures.
Ezekiel 28:13 describes Eden's precious stones covering, using similar gem imagery but in a different context.
